Decide destinations based on everyone's interests for a fun family trip
The first step is to decide where you want to go. Consider everyone's interests when brainstorming destinations. Maybe the kids want to visit a theme park, while the grandparents prefer a relaxing hill station.

It is very important to set the tone right with everyone early on to avoid any miscommunication in the future. A great way is to list all these preferences out and involve everyone in the decision-making process, instead of just one member of the family.
You can also consider a destination that offers a mix of activities, like beaches with water sports and nearby historical sites. Remember to factor in travel time and budget. If you have young children, a shorter flight or train ride might be preferable.
Most of all, make sure there will be fun for all ages.
Book travel and accommodation wisely for a hassle-free trip
Once you've chosen a destination, it's time to book your travel and accommodation. Book well in advance, especially if you're travelling during peak season. This will give you a better chance of securing the best deals and preferred accommodations.

Consider family-friendly hotels or resorts that offer amenities like kids' clubs, swimming pools, and on-site dining options. If you're traveling with a larger group, renting a vacation home or apartment might be more economical and provide more space.
When booking flights, look for seats together, or consider paying a small fee to reserve your seats in advance. Don't forget to check baggage allowances and any restrictions on what you can carry.
Pack appropriately for all conditions, include meds, first-aid, docs, involve kids, check forecasts
Pack appropriately for all weather conditions and activities, and make sure to pack essential medicines and any necessary prescriptions. Prepare a first-aid kit with bandages, antiseptic wipes, pain relievers, and any personal medications.
Always carry a copy of important documents like passports, ID proofs, and insurance details. It can be helpful to scan these documents and store them electronically as well. When packing for kids, involve them in the process.
Let them choose their own clothes and pack a few of their favorite toys or books. This will make them feel more involved and excited about the trip. Check weather forecasts for the destinations, prior to packing your clothes.
Plan itinerary with breaks, involve all, be flexible for fun trips
Plan your itinerary, make sure to factor in downtime. Trying to cram too much into each day can lead to exhaustion and stress, especially for young children and older adults. Schedule breaks throughout the day for rest and relaxation. Also, involve everyone in planning the itinerary.

Ask for their suggestions on what activities they'd like to do. This will ensure that everyone feels like they're part of the planning process, thereby increasing their chances of having fun. Be prepared to be flexible and adjust the itinerary as needed.
Weather conditions, unexpected delays, or simply a change of pace can all affect your plans. Don't be afraid to deviate from the itinerary and try something new.
Delegate tasks, stay positive, be patient, capture memories on trip
On the trip, delegate responsibilities. Share tasks such as navigating, packing snacks, and entertaining the kids. This will help to reduce the load on any one person and ensure that everyone feels like they’re contributing. Maintain a positive attitude throughout the trip.

Traveling can be stressful at times, but try to remain calm and optimistic. Remember, the goal is to have fun and create lasting memories. Encourage everyone to be patient and understanding of each other.
Small problems can arise, but with a bit of humor and flexibility, they can often be resolved easily. Lastly, capture memories, take lots of pictures or videos to document your experiences.
